Are you ready to respond effectively in a cardiac emergency? As a potential first responder, your ability to recognize and react to cardiac arrest can mean the difference between life and death for someone in crisis. This interactive online course is designed to help you understand the essential skills of c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R), including how to perform chest compressions, deliver rescue breaths, and use automated external defibrillators (AEDs) for adults, children, and infants. You will learn the complete chain of survival, proper techniques for different age groups, and critical best practices that align with the American Heart Association’s latest guidelines, empowering you with the knowledge needed to act confidently and effectively during a cardiac emergency.
